stunningpixels / chrome-storage-promise

A chrome.storage wrapper that is using promise

Geek Repo:Geek Repo

Github PK Tool:Github PK Tool

chrome-storage-promise

npm version Bower version Dependency Status Build Status

Installation

npm

npm install --save chrome-storage-promise

bower

bower install --save chrome-storage-promise

Usage

// set
chrome.storage.promise.local.set({'foo': 'bar'}).then(function() {
  // resolved
  console.log('set');
}, function(error) {
  // rejected
  console.log(error);
});

// get
chrome.storage.promise.local.get('foo').then(function(items) {
  // resolved
  console.log(items); // => {'foo': 'bar'}
}, function(error) {
  // rejected
  console.log(error);
});

Development

Build

npm install
npm run build

Test

npm install
npm run build
npm test

Lisence

The MIT License.

About

A chrome.storage wrapper that is using promise


Languages

Language:JavaScript 100.0%